At this time, the threat of coronavirus remains everywhere and people are looking upset and shocked by it. Constant concerns were being expressed in Bollywood about those who work on daily wages. Many Bollywood stars are coming forward to help them all. According to the recent announcement made by Yash Raj, Rs 5000-5000 will be sent directly to the accounts of 3000 Daily Wage Workers actively working in Yash Chopra Foundation Mumbai.

In this context, the Yash Raj banner has announced a donation of Rs 1.5 crore. According to the information received, due to the Coronavirus, the bandh in the country has affected the daily earning people in Bollywood and they have reached a state of desperation. Due to the three-week shutdown, many people are struggling to meet their daily needs. However, apart from Yash Chopra Foundation, Bollywood superstar Salman Khan has come forward to provide financial assistance to 25,000 such people.

Not only this, Rohit Shetty has given assistance of 52 lakh rupees to the Federation but still this section has not got help. On this, 26-year-old Spot Boy Koshal Sharma says, 'The last 100 rupees left in his pocket have been spent. He can neither go out nor do anything in such a situation. He wants to return to his home in Jammu and Kashmir but he does not know how he will go.
